Interesting take on 6AA....The following is my count of the number of players who will be skating in the Sectioin 6AA Semifinals at BIG on Saturday who grew up playing in the Edina Hockey Association. Pretty interesting to see the feeding/development from that program....This is a simple analysis of the currently-posted rosters:
--Blake: 7 skaters from EHA
--Benilde: 3 skaters from EHA
--Cretin: 0 skaters from EHA (why are they in Section 6AA anyway??--OOPS, different topic
--Edina: 21 skaters from EHA
Total of 31 kids from that association going to be skating in two games, spread among three different teams.
